@austindonald1 As @Jack Swart mentioned, having your onboard graphics enabled plus a discrete graphics card does not work well, if at all. It can be done theoretically but often their are conflicts with graphics card drivers and the whole system becomes unusable/unstable. Not sure that reasoning was clear in Jack's post.

Best to attach everything to a discrete graphics card, most usually have 2-4 outputs on them (sometime a few different connector types, but many can be adapted or monitors often have multiple input types too).
